Jenny Hval – Female Vampire
Everybody’s favourite Norwegian with a bowl cut Jenny Hval is coming for blood. After last year’s mesmerizing “Apocalypse, girl“, Hval is ready to venture deeper into the forest of symbols gender and body politics live in with her new album “Blood Bitch”. The LP focuses on the most elemental of those symbols, menstruation, the red thread the album has been woven with. It’s a fictitious yet personal story populated by characters from ’70s exploitation and horror movies. Please meet the first of these shadowy figures in “Female Vampire”.
Marissa Nadler – All The Colors Of The Dark
After the beautiful lead single “Janie In Love“, that is by the way still ranked at the 23rd rank in the HighClouds30 of this week, Boston-based American singer-songwriter, guitarist, and painter Marissa Nadler keeps on preparing the ground for the release of “Strangers”, her seventh album that will be available on May 20, via Sacred Bones/Bella Union. Discover her self-directed and animated black and white video for her new single “All The Colors Of The Dark”.
